Former President Praises Hannibal Lecter and Slams Immigrants at Wildwood Rally!

At a political rally in Wildwood, New Jersey, on Saturday, the former president praised the fictional serial killer Hannibal Lecter as "a wonderful man" from the movie Silence of the Lambs, before criticizing undocumented immigrants in the US. Speaking to a crowd of about 80,000 supporters, he used Lecter as a metaphor while condemning those entering the country without permission. The rally, held under the shadow of the Great White roller coaster, was part of the former president's campaign against Joe Biden's re-election.

The former president has previously expressed admiration for Lecter, echoing comments made by actor Mads Mikkelsen, who portrayed Lecter in a TV series. The event also saw the former president repeating false claims about being indicted more times than Al Capone, despite facing only four indictments related to attempts to overturn the 2020 election and other charges.

Despite the enthusiastic support from his followers, the former president faced criticism from New Jersey Democrats, who dismissed the rally's significance. Congresswoman Mikie Sherrill noted that many attendees were from out of state, while Congressman Andy Kim criticized the former president's divisive politics.
